#032130 Color Information

In a RGB color space, hex #032130 is composed of 1.2% red, 12.9% green and 18.8% blue. Whereas in a CMYK color space, it is composed of 93.8% cyan, 31.3% magenta, 0% yellow and 81.2% black. It has a hue angle of 200 degrees, a saturation of 88.2% and a lightness of 10%. #032130 color hex could be obtained by blending #064260 with #000000. Closest websafe color is: #003333.

#032130 color description : Very dark (mostly black) blue.

#032130 Color Conversion

The hexadecimal color #032130 has RGB values of R:3, G:33, B:48 and CMYK values of C:0.94, M:0.31, Y:0, K:0.81. Its decimal value is 205104.

Shades and Tints of #032130

A shade is achieved by adding black to any pure hue, while a tint is created by mixing white to any pure color. In this example, #01080b is the darkest color, while #f8fcff is the lightest one.
